    Everyone’s entitled to their own opinion and criticism is honestly far more valuable than most of the gushing on this thread. You at least are articulating what you like about it. But for me, your post actually sums up pretty well what I personally feel is wrong with the official MP fandom. “I really like it and my inner child goes ‘sqweeee’ so therefore it’s perfect and no criticism is accepted.” “Takara can do no wrong”. There’s a very strong tendency to ignore any rational criticism or disagreement and avoid any attempt at an unbiais ed view from a lot of people.
    There are plenty of genuine criticisms of this figure, from the gappy shoulders, to the too narrow waist, to the kibbly backpack. And all over there’s very much a sense of gaps and panels and stuff kind of fitting together, rather than large smooth pieces of solid plastic. Compared to that Hound, the front of Optimus is really bitsy - it’s almost a Bayformers vibe with so many little panels, at least to me.
    Some feel those are dealbreakers, some think they are minor and many just seem not to notice or care. And all of that is fine.
    For me, this is okay. It’s not the slam dunk for me that it is for many others. It’s at best on par with the two 3P efforts. Colour may change that. And colour may also improve those other two.
    I’m glad this gives you the buzz you’re looking for but I just get an “ ehhh, it’s not bad I guess” vibe. Doesn’t make me less of a fan, doesn’t mean my inner child is being ignored. Maybe my inner child just remembers Prime differently to how yours does. {shrug}
    But I will reiterate that I feel attempts to highlight what is both good and bad about this figure are far more valuable and interesting than most of the senseless fanboy gushing. But, to paraphrase “that’s just like my opinion, man”
